What this page is about

This page is part of a larger set of rankings for research items, serials, authors and institutions made available on this site. A FAQ is available.

  • Only authors registered with the RePEc Author Service are considered.
  • Only works listed on RePEc and claimed as theirs by registered authors are counted.
  • A series of rankings by different criteria are aggregated. The average rank score is determined by taking a harmonic mean of the ranks in each criterion. For a list of criteria, see the general ranking page.
  • Authors with multiple affiliations are attributed to each institution according to the weights they have set to each in their profile, or by default according to a formula described here.
  • Authors affiliated with subentities of institutions listed in EDIRC are also counted in the latter.
  • Only institutions listed in EDIRC are counted.
  • Subentities of ranked institutions do not increment the rank count and have their rank listed in parentheses.
  • The scores of institutions in each field are determined by a weighted sum of all scores of authors affiliated with the respective institutions, where the authors have provided weights if they have multiple affiliations. The weights are determined, for each author, by the proportion of all working papers announced in NEP that have also been announced in this NEP report.
  • To be classified, an author needs to have five or more working papers announced in the NEP report for this field. For authors whose first paper is less that 10 years old, having 25% of the papers in the NEP report is sufficient.
  • There are no such restrictions for institutions, it is thus possible that more institutions than authors are classified.
  • Please note that rankings can depend on the number of registered authors in the respective institutions. Register at the RePEc Author Service to be counted.
  • There are 8251 institutions with 61047 registered authors evaluated for all the rankings.

The data presented here is experimental. It is based on a limited sample of the research output in Economics and Finance. Only material catalogued in RePEc is considered. For any citation based criterion, only works that could be parsed by the CitEc project are considered. For any ranking of people, only those registered with the RePEc Author Service can be taken into account. And for rankings of institutions, only those listed in EDIRC and claimed as affiliation by the respective, registered authors can be measured. Thus, this list is by no means based on a complete sample.
